February 2006 page 14 Evaluation and Management, 99201, 99211 (Q&A) Question Recently, a new physician of a different specialty joined our practice. Several of her previous patients are now coming to this office, and we are wondering whether these patients will be considered new or established when she sees them for the first time in this practice. Can you please clarify? AMA Comment A new patient is one who has not received any professional services from the physician or another physician of the same specialty who belongs to the same group practice within the past 3 years.
